How to Choose the Right Generative AI Development Company

A few practical things to check before signing any contract:

Be specific when defining your case, as a customer support chatbot and an internal document intelligence system will require entirely different skill sets Calculate industry experience, particularly in areas like healthcare or finance Ask about post-launch integrity, including support and retraining of the original model Check independent site reviews like Clutch or G2, not just their website testimonials In addition, consider an offshore-hybrid solution - companies such as Vasundhara Infotech provide high-quality US-based Generative AI solutions at price points that are accessible to mid-range businesses.

US-based agencies typically charge $150–$300/hr. Offshore-hybrid companies like Vasundhara Infotech offer comparable quality under $50/hr. Full projects range from $5,000 for a simple MVP to $100,000+ for enterprise-grade custom AI systems.
A basic chatbot or automation tool takes 4–8 weeks. Custom LLM fine-tuning or multi-agent systems typically take 3–6 months. Data readiness is the biggest variable — clean data means faster delivery.
Not always. Good development companies help with data collection and prep. That said, proprietary data significantly improves model accuracy.
Yes, when built by a qualified partner. Always ask about GDPR, HIPAA, or SOC 2 compliance, how they handle data after the engagement, and what security standards they follow during development.
Yes. Many companies now offer phased, modular projects starting at $5,000–$15,000. Starting with one well-defined use case — solved well — almost always outperforms a large, unfocused AI initiative anyway.
